Leopards . Wildlife photography workshop Sri Lanka

Leopards, wildlife photography workshop Sri Lanka. Leopards. Wildlife photography workshop Sri Lanka Some wildlife experts believe that Yala National Park houses one of the world’s highest density of leopards. See what we photographed in the wildlife photography workshop in Sri Lanka. Since leopard in Sri Lanka stays at the top of the predator tree (unlike the tiger... Continue Reading →

Blog at WordPress.com.

Up ↑